Abstract

The advent of the big data era has brought tremendous development opportunities to scientific research management in universities, and led the development of scientific research management. However, the era of big data also raised new requirements for scientific research management. This paper discusses the scientific research management in universities, at the same time, put forward the innovative coping strategies.
